The Silent Crisis: Why America’s Workforce Policy Is Failing Its Most Critical Asset
For decades, the American workforce development narrative has been defined by a singular, persistent mission: providing a path to the middle class for those without higher education. With nearly 20,000 training providers—ranging from community colleges and vocational schools to specialized nonprofits—and billions of dollars in annual federal funding through the Workforce Innovation and Opportunity Act (WIOA), the United States has constructed a robust apparatus for entry-level skill acquisition. In 2024–25 alone, employers poured more than $100 billion into workplace training.
Yet, beneath the veneer of this massive industrial machine lies a glaring, systemic blind spot. Current workforce development agendas are optimized for access and speed, focusing almost exclusively on foundational skills and career entry. In doing so, they have systematically overlooked a population that is increasingly vulnerable to the rapid, tectonic shifts of the modern economy: degree-holding professionals.
The Disruption of the Credentialed Class
The prevailing assumption that an advanced degree provides permanent insulation against obsolescence is no longer tenable. For years, the implicit social contract suggested that while non-degreed workers required ongoing vocational training, professionals needed only the occasional seminar or workshop to stay current. Today, that assumption has been dismantled by the pace of technological and regulatory change.
Engineers, clinicians, managers, scientists, and analysts—the very professionals who sit at the heart of our innovation economy—are facing the most complex retraining challenges in history. Their work is increasingly data-intensive, technology-mediated, and subject to volatile regulatory landscapes. When these professionals lag, the impact is not confined to their individual careers; institutions lose capacity, industrial sectors experience stagnation, and the broader national economy suffers a decline in competitiveness.

Chronology of an Evolving Mismatch
The disconnect between traditional academic structures and labor market requirements has widened significantly over the last decade.
- 1990s–2000s: The rise of the "degree-as-the-final-credential" mindset. Higher education institutions solidified their status as the primary gatekeepers of professional entry, with curricula largely static and research-focused.
- 2010–2018: The emergence of the "boot camp" era. Private providers stepped in to fill the gap for rapid digital skill acquisition, primarily targeting tech-adjacent entry-level roles.
- 2019–2023: The "Great Acceleration." The COVID-19 pandemic forced a digital transformation across every sector, exposing the inability of traditional four-year degrees to adapt to changing toolsets and workflows within a two-year window.
- 2024–Present: The "Skills Gap" crisis. Employers report that even graduates from elite institutions possess strong mental frameworks but lack the practical command of current tools, workflows, and regulatory frameworks necessary to hit the ground running.
Traditional academic processes, characterized by multilayered faculty committees and rigorous governance, are designed to ensure long-term quality, not short-term agility. By the time a degree program updates its curriculum to reflect a new industry standard, the labor market has often moved on to the next iteration.
The Role of Professional and Continuing Education (PCE)
If community colleges are the backbone of the entry-level workforce, then Professional and Continuing Education (PCE) units within research universities are the brain trust of the professional class. Currently, these units are the most underutilized asset in American higher education.
Unlike the ivory tower of traditional departments, PCE units act as a bridge between frontier research and applied learning. They are designed to translate complex, cutting-edge discoveries into actionable curriculum for midcareer adults. Because they often operate with a degree of structural independence from traditional degree-granting departments, they can move at the speed of the labor market.
Why PCE Units Are Uniquely Positioned
- Contextualized Expertise: PCE units do not just teach software; they teach the application of tools within specific, high-stakes disciplinary contexts.
- Institutional Credibility: For a senior pharmaceutical scientist or a healthcare executive, a certificate issued by a research-intensive university carries a level of weight and "signaling power" that a third-party boot camp cannot replicate.
- Employer Collaboration: PCE divisions often work in direct partnership with regional industry leaders to design programs that specifically address the "leadership skills gap"—the inability of current managers to translate technical changes into organizational strategy.
The Limits of Current Policy: The "Workforce Pell" Dilemma
Recent legislative efforts, such as the introduction of "Workforce Pell" grants, represent a meaningful step forward in recognizing that non-degree training has real economic value. By expanding Pell eligibility to include short-term, workforce-aligned programs, policymakers have acknowledged that the four-year degree is not the only path to prosperity.
However, the current legislative framework remains trapped in an "entry-level" mindset. Most existing policy is designed to help individuals transition into a job, not to help established professionals transition through their careers. The statutory requirement that many eligible programs must bridge to a full degree creates an unnecessary hurdle for a 45-year-old engineer who does not need a second bachelor’s degree, but rather a targeted, modular sequence of courses on AI-driven design systems.
As states begin to write the implementation rules for these programs, there is a narrow window of opportunity. Policy must shift to recognize that "workforce development" includes the ongoing renewal of the professional class. This requires valuing metrics such as role expansion, wage growth, and long-term organizational retention, rather than just immediate job placement.
Implications for the Future Economy
The failure to integrate PCE units into the national workforce agenda will have compounding negative effects. We risk creating a "skills ceiling" for the very individuals tasked with leading our most critical institutions.
The Economic Consequences
- Institutional Drag: When managers cannot keep pace with new technologies, organizations become inefficient. This creates a drag on innovation that ripples across the entire sector.
- Brain Drain: Without local, accessible pathways for reskilling, highly specialized professionals may stagnate or leave the workforce entirely, leading to a loss of institutional knowledge.
- The Credential Gap: The economy will continue to see a surplus of entry-level talent and a persistent, widening shortage of mid-to-senior level talent capable of navigating high-complexity environments.
